choose the right cable for each application
The diversity of onboard equipment requires cables adapted to each need. From simple power cables to complex communication networks, choosing the right cable is crucial to avoid signal loss, interference, and failures. It is essential to consider the cable's cross-section, insulation, and resistance to marine conditions.
- DC power cable: Calculate the cross-section based on the distance and the device's power consumption (in Amps) to minimize voltage drop.
- NMEA 2000 cable: Ensure compatibility with the backbone network and choose waterproof connectors.
- Ethernet cable: For reliable data transmission, choose shielded cables of category 5e or higher.
- Coaxial cable: Select a low-loss cable for VHF, AIS and radar applications.
the importance of connectors and accessories
Quality cabling isn't just about the cables themselves. Connectors, cable glands, heat-shrink tubing, and other accessories play a crucial role in protecting connections from corrosion, moisture, and vibration. A neat and watertight assembly is essential to ensure the longevity of your installation.
- Waterproof connectors: Use IP67 or IP68 connectors for areas exposed to water spray.
- Heat shrink tubing: Ensure perfect insulation of connections and protect them against corrosion.
- Cable glands: Ensure watertightness at cable passages in bulkheads or decks.
- Terminal blocks: Facilitate the distribution of power and the connection of different equipment.
💡 Skysat's advice
Before you begin your wiring, create a precise diagram of your installation. Take into account the required cable lengths, access points, and potential hazards. A clear plan will prevent costly mistakes and facilitate future maintenance.
